Meet Blockchain Pioneer Dr. Scott Stornetta

September 27-28, 2021/ Washington DC. The GBA, along with an assembly of blockchain associations, will present Blockchain & Infrastructure. During the recent Infrastructure legislation debate, one thing became crystal clear: policymakers need to have a solid understanding of blockchain and cryptocurrency if they are going to regulate it. And who better to teach the history of blockchain than Dr. Scott Stornetta? The works of the Doctor and his colleague, cryptographer Stuart Haber, were referenced three times in Satoshi Nakamoto’s 2009 bitcoin whitepaper. One could argue that Stornetta taught Satoshi how to blockchain.
